Sir,

Although there are many outlets of MysoreOne in the city, one has to go to only the Gokulam Office for getting Aadhaar card-related things done. The other day l had gone there to just update my mobile number and it took more than three hours! There is only one system and one person attending to the people in the queue, who takes at least 15 to 20 minutes per person. There were many families with little kids applying for Aadhaar Cards. Naturally, it consumes more time and one cannot blame the person attending to the system. I would request the authorities concerned to give at least one more system in that office to attend to the Aadhaar card applicants. That would ease the problem of people who come there with their small kids. Otherwise, some more outlets of MysoreOne should look into Aadhaar applications.
